Hello All,
  I am having difficulty resolving Reverse DNS for 167.216.129.170,
and I'm not entirely certain why.  If I just do a dig -x
167.216.129.170 I get:

; <<>> DiG 9.7.3 <<>> -x 167.216.129.170
;; global options: +cmd
;; connection timed out; no servers could be reached


If I dig -x +trace 167.216.129.170:

;; Got answer:
;; ->>HEADER<<- opcode: QUERY, status: NXDOMAIN, id: 28671
;; flags: qr rd ra; QUERY: 1, ANSWER: 0, AUTHORITY: 1, ADDITIONAL: 0

;; QUESTION SECTION:
;167.216.129.170.               IN      A

;; AUTHORITY SECTION:
.                       10549   IN      SOA     a.root-servers.net.
nstld.verisign-grs.com. 2014091100 1800 900 604800 86400


and finally, if I  dig -x 167.216.129.170 @8.8.8.8:

;; Got answer:
;; ->>HEADER<<- opcode: QUERY, status: NOERROR, id: 58383
;; flags: qr rd ra; QUERY: 1, ANSWER: 2, AUTHORITY: 0, ADDITIONAL: 0

;; QUESTION SECTION:
;170.129.216.167.in-addr.arpa.  IN      PTR

;; ANSWER SECTION:
170.129.216.167.in-addr.arpa. 3047 IN   CNAME
170.0-24.129.216.167.in-addr.arpa.
170.0-24.129.216.167.in-addr.arpa. 3047 IN PTR  nmail2.netsuite.com.


This is impacting my ability to receive transactional emails from this
IP address in particular.  My DNS server is running Bind 9.7.3 on
Debian Squeeze.  I thought perhaps my DNS server was being blocked,
but that wouldn't explain the NXDOMAIN I don't believe.  I apologize
in advance if this is something simple and/or obvious, but can anyone
explain what is happening and/or how to correct it?  Many thanks in
advance!
